  1. On Sunday 3rd of May we are taking our FWD Model B on the London to Brighton run. Joining us will be another US WW1 FWD Model B, a civilian McCurd lorry (which although a civilian is of the same type used by the ASC during the war) and pershings Doughboys the WW1 US Army Living History Unit.

     

    We will be leaving South terrace car park at Crystal Palace at 7:40 and should be at Madeira drive for around mid day (hopefully).

     

    It will be interesting to have two US military scheme Model B FWD's together. Something not seen in this country for a very long time. This will be the longest journey undertaken by either of these FWD's since their restoration. Wish us luck.
